Procedural Posture

Miscellaneous Land Application / Ruling on Application for Temporary Injunction

  1. 1 Whether the applicant is entitled to a temporary injunction restraining sale of matrimonial properties pending determination of the main suit

Ratio Decidendi

The applicant met the three conditions for granting a temporary injunction as set out in Atilio vs. Mbowe; the application was not contested, and the applicant demonstrated risk of irreparable harm and lack of consent to the mortgage.

Court Disposition

Application granted

Orders

  • Temporary injunction granted restraining sale of suit properties pending hearing and determination of Land Case No. 39 of 2022
  • No order as to costs
